Joining of VCS Equality and Diversity Advisory Group and the County Equalities Network
The VCS Assembly Equalities and Diversity Group and County Equalities Officers Group met on the 26th of February 2010 .  The meeting agreed that the two groups join to form one County Equalities Group, creating a stronger platform for discussion and co-ordination of county issues relating to the promotion of equalities and diversity. 

Discussion items included Gloucestershire Homeseeker, county equality schemes and the Local Area Agreement.  It was agreed that there was a need to co-ordinate activities and strategies relating to the promotion of community cohesion and equality across the Local Area Agreement and scrutinise the process and results of Equality Impact Assessments conducted across the Gloucestershire Conference.

The group welcomed the appointment of Dr Shona Arora, Director of Public Health at NHS Gloucestershire as the new Equalities Champion on the Community Strategy Executive Board.  Shona will be providing strategic leadership in promoting equality and diversity issues relating to significant county policy initiatives and commissioning opportunities.

County Equality Group seeks to widen membership

Funding for the VCS Equality and Diversity Advisory Group (EDAG) came to an end at the end of 2009.  The developing partnership between EDAG and the County Equalities Network (CEN) was also felt to be significant and useful.

The VCS Assembly Team would like to continue to support joint meetings between EDAG and CEN, and the group agreed that:

  • EDAG membership would be opened up to other members of the VCS who have knowledge and experience on issues relating to equalities
  • EDAG members would need to continue to be committed to attending 75% of meetings and taking on some work. The group would not be a networking group.

VCS Faith Communities Strategy Group

A faith communities strategy group was funded in 2007/8.  This group is no longer in operation.  Faith issues are now discussed by the County Equality Group.
